If you work from home or in front of a screen for long periods, limiting screen time is the first step to better sleep. The blue light emitted from screens can disrupt your body’s circadian rhythms and disrupt your sleep cycle. According to the American Psychological Association, people who constantly check their electronic devices for email, social media accounts, and texts are, on average, more stressed out. While being plugged in might be necessary for work, it doesn’t have to be when you’re off the clock. Ever noticed how certain smells can make you feel certain things? For example, how the smell of vanilla can transport you right to an excited Christmas morning or how the smell of a certain perfume can remind you of a holiday you took. I suggest choosing a candle, incense, or diffusers scent that you can light as soon as you get home, to help further that feeling of calm and relaxation.
